(Not) LEGO Dragon Lands is a MOC series that's meant to be like a new theme of LEGO fantasy; as such, the creations below are designed to be as stable, functional, and reasonably-sized as real LEGO sets. The creations I make in my "themes" (I've done several like this in the past) are designed to complement each other, and be highly playable as a cohesive theme.Like I said, this is the topic for the imaginary third wave of Dragon Lands (wave one can be seen in-depth here, and wave two here). This arc is a lot of fun for me because it's a prequel story to the first two. The orc-like Ustokal race and the elegant woodland Faeries - allies of the humans of the Kingdom of Ardun - are in the throes of an age-old war where sorcerers, dragons, and magical artifacts become valuable weapons! For those of you who remember the first two waves, this is all happening a generation before them... Some of the oldest characters, like Althior, Scallow, and Rothut are visibly younger in this story (that was fun to play with!); the Ustokal Vorash is still a prince; the legendary fire drake Radgha - who appeared as an undead dragon in wave two - is still alive.In making this wave, I wanted to implement more - and more diverse - play features in the dragons themselves. You'll see dragons with flapping wings, striking heads, and more; all of that was a real blast to design, on top of creating a few new dragon characters. I've also enjoyed building other types of fantastical creatures this time around, like the Golem in 64030, and exploring new locations and structures. The more I build in the Dragon Lands vein, the more easily it comes; I've just been having a blast with the project so far.
